Project: Beneteau Project E 62

During the Dusseldorf 2020 boat show, Beneteau presented its Project E.  A concept of modern Mediterranean explorer yacht Project E is the result of Beneteau's collaboration with Massimo Gino of Nauta Design and Amedeo Migali of Micad and capitalize on the highly successful Swift Trawler range of practical, spacious boats, with a considerable cruising range, and put Groupe Beneteau’s experience in producing luxury boats to good use.  These new explorer yachts will have a distinctive displacement hull, developed by Micad with the aim of improving their cruising range and efficiency, making it easier for owners to cast off on long-distance cruises. A satin wax finished wood, leather and elegant textiles make for a stylish interior and exterior, carefully designed by the experts at Nauta Design. Strikingly spacious inside, with volumes similar to much bigger yachts, and ingeniously designed, these large passage makers also have enough space to comfortably house a crew. The first model in the Project E presented here the is the eighteen meters long 62.  The Beneteau Project E 62 will a full beam of over five meters. Designed for six to eight people on board, the Project E 62 will have an impressive flybridge, one of the biggest in its class and size. The interior spaces are spacious and well-appointed. The galley can be completely enclosed. The VIP guest cabin in the bow, has a considerable amount of headroom, so that you feel like you are in a hotel suite. Comfortable and seaworthy, the Beneteau Project E will have a cruising range of up to nine hundred nautical miles.  Project E is to launch in Dusseldorf 2021 and so far we do not know if they will be a separate line or make part of the Swift Trawler range.
